Crystal reports Crystal报告将各个部分放在同一行上

Crystal reports Crystal报告将各个部分放在同一行上,crystal-reports,Crystal Reports,是否可以在同一行中显示两个组和详细信息?我的crystal report有两个组,我将它们放在一起 电流输出为: LocName Date un1 un2 ------------------------------- LocNAme Date compl compl compl compl LocName和Date已分组 我希望输出为: LocName Date un1

是否可以在同一行中显示两个组和详细信息?我的crystal report有两个组,我将它们放在一起

电流输出为:

LocName   Date  un1     un2 
-------------------------------
LocNAme  
        Date 
              compl     compl
              compl     compl
LocName和Date已分组

我希望输出为:

LocName   Date  un1     un2 
-------------------------------
 LocNAme  Date  compl     compl
                compl     compl

您可以将组标题从组2向上移动到组标题1旁边,然后抑制组2。我不认为有一种方法可以在同一行中显示细节。由于我不知道您的数据,请确保在您这样做之后,您仍然显示正确的数据

希望有帮助

克里斯

编辑:

下面是一个报告的屏幕截图,其中两个组和详细信息部分位于同一行。 我这样做的方式是:取消组1,将组1分组依据的字段放在组标题2中,然后创建一个子报告来显示详细信息部分。子报表由组1和组2的字段链接。

您可以将组标题2从日期组移动到组标题1(LocName),使其显示在同一行中。要在同一行中获得详细信息,您需要插入显示Compl数据的子报表。将该子报告链接到LocName,您就可以开始了

编辑:由于您不能将子报表放入子报表中,我想最接近的解决方案是将两个组标题放在同一级别,并包含下面的详细信息。在主报告中使用组1,然后创建包含组2和详细信息的子报告。请参阅添加的屏幕截图。子报表周围有边框


您的分组在LOCNAME和DATE上。要获得所需的输出,请尝试以下步骤:

1] 在详细信息字段中显示LOCNAME和DATE列。(不应删除分组)

2] 右键单击LOCNAME列,然后单击格式化字段

3] 在“常用”选项卡下,选中标签为“重复时抑制”的复选框

4] 对于日期列也要遵循类似的步骤

5] 如果不想在组标题中显示组名,请隐藏两个组


我希望这有帮助

首先右键单击报告并转到“报告-->选择专家”。转到“常用”选项卡。从右侧选择组标题名称“LocName”,然后从“公用”选项卡中选中“参考底图以下部分”选项。然后选择“日期”组标题,并选中“参考底图以下部分”。现在你将得到你的欲望输出


对不起,我的英语不好:)

如果我将第2组移到组组长1旁边,则第2组数据显示不正确。我只是用日期做了一个快速报告。我认为,由于日期的原因,您必须这样做:抑制组1(LocName),然后将LocName字段拖到组头2中并将其加粗。现在,您应该看到LocName和Date紧挨着彼此,详细信息如下。在更改日期或位置名称时,您应该获得一个新的组标题。再一次,我认为除非你可能使用子报告,否则你不能将详细信息放在组标题行上。有时我必须显示多个locname..如果这样做。我可以在需要显示多个locname时获得正确的报告如果你按位置分组,它将显示一个位置的所有数据,然后显示下一个位置。先生,特定位置我会以不同的日期显示数据,因此,如果我将组标题2日期组移动到组标题1,则不会显示不同的日期数据,而是会显示数据。将“组标题2”字段移动到“组标题1”级别后,请确保取消显示组2(日期)。我在回答中添加了一个屏幕截图。在第1组中,我必须显示不同类型的第2组,如果我这样给出,我只得到一个日期,没有得到不同的日期,请尝试为第2组创建一个子报告。这次我尝试给第1组“如果重复,则显示最高级”,然后第1组也重复请附上屏幕截图,那么我将能够进一步帮助您。先生,我检查了这个链接,现在我得到了确切的信息: